溫馨提示×

Java在Ubuntu上編譯出錯怎么辦

小樊
47
2025-08-25 18:01:20
欄目: 編程語言

在Ubuntu上編譯Java程序時出錯,可能有以下幾種原因:

  1. Java未安裝或版本不正確:請確保已正確安裝Java,并且版本與您的代碼兼容。您可以通過運行以下命令來檢查Java版本:
java -version
javac -version

如果需要安裝或更新Java,請訪問Oracle官方網站下載并安裝適用于Ubuntu的JDK。

  1. 編譯命令錯誤:確保您使用的編譯命令正確。一個典型的Java編譯命令如下:
javac HelloWorld.java

請根據您的文件名和類名進行調整。

  1. 類路徑問題:如果您的項目依賴于外部庫,請確保已將它們添加到類路徑中。您可以使用-cp-classpath選項來設置類路徑,例如:
javac -cp .:/path/to/your/library.jar HelloWorld.java
  1. 編碼問題:如果您的源代碼包含非ASCII字符,請確保在編譯時指定正確的字符編碼。例如,使用UTF-8編碼:
javac -encoding UTF-8 HelloWorld.java
  1. 文件名或類名錯誤:請確保您的文件名和類名與Java文件的public class聲明相匹配。例如,如果您的類名為HelloWorld,則文件名應為HelloWorld.java。

如果您仍然遇到問題,請提供更多關于錯誤的詳細信息,例如錯誤消息、代碼片段等,以便我們能夠更好地幫助您解決問題。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女